GPT-4V(ision) system card
OpenAI unveils the GPT-4V(ision) system card, enhancing AI's visual and text processing capabilities.
OpenAI has officially introduced the GPT-4V(ision) system card, a significant enhancement to its AI capabilities that integrates visual understanding with text processing. This innovative system card allows the model to process multimodal inputs, enabling richer and more interactive user experiences. By combining visual data with textual information, GPT-4V(ision) aims to elevate the standard for AI interactions, making them more intuitive and context-aware than ever before.
The introduction of the GPT-4V(ision) system card marks a pivotal moment in the evolution of AI technology. OpenAI's commitment to advancing its models is evident in this latest release, which not only enhances the capabilities of existing AI systems but also sets a new benchmark for future developments. The integration of visual understanding into the GPT-4 architecture allows developers to create applications that can interpret and respond to a wide array of inputs, from images to text, thereby broadening the scope of potential use cases.
